"Frank Sinatra" is the name of a single by alternative rock band Cake, released from their hit 1996 record, Fashion Nugget. It was used at the end of The Sopranos episode "The Legend of Tennessee Moltisanti."

Best-known for their ubiquitous hit "The Distance," Cake epitomized the postmodern, irony-drenched aesthetic of '90s geek rock. Their sound freely mixed and matched pastiches of widely varying genres – white-boy funk, hip-hop, country, new wave pop, jazz, college rock, and guitar rock – with a particular delight in the clashes that resulted.
